全球批准的COVID-19疫苗:系统审查
Brenda de Almeida Perret Magalhães1,2,3, Jéssica Medeiros Minasi4, Rubens Caurio Lobato5
1Interdisciplinary Group of Virology and Immunology, Faculty of Medicine, Federal University of Rio Grande (FURG), Rio Grande, RS, Brazil. bperret1008@gmail.com.
概括
这次系统性审查分析了已批准的COVID-19疫苗,发现它们通常表现出高效率和安全性. 现实世界的有效性各不相同,一些疫苗的影响低于最初的有效率.

背景情况:
- 由于COVID-19的流行,需要快速开发疫苗.
- 了解批准疫苗的特征对于公共卫生战略至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 系统地审查和分析全球批准的COVID-19疫苗的一般特征.
- 总结疫苗的成分,剂量,疗效和不良影响.
主要方法:
- 按照PRISMA指南进行系统审查.
- 搜索了MEDLINE和Web of Science的第三阶段研究 (2020年1月至2023年6月).
- 包括11项关于世卫组织批准的疫苗的研究.
主要成果:
- 所有审查的疫苗都在预防症状性COVID-19方面表现出高效.
- 大多数疫苗都报告了轻度至中度的不良反应.
- 现实世界的有效性各不相同,一些疫苗的有效性低于有效性.
结论:
- 经批准的COVID-19疫苗通常是安全有效的.
- 疫苗的成分,剂量和研究设计都会影响结果.
- 有效性数据可能无法完全预测现实世界的影响.

Simple proteins and protein complexes contain only amino acids. In contrast, many other proteins, called conjugated proteins, covalently bond with non-protein moieties.
Nucleoproteins are protein complexes that contain nucleic acids, categorized as deoxyribonucleoproteins (DNPs) or ribonucleoproteins (RNPs) respectively. The nucleosome is a typical example of a DNP where nuclear DNA is associated with histone proteins. The major antigen for the Covid-19 virus SARS-CoV is an RNP that is critical...

Microorganisms in Medicine and Therapeutics
Microorganisms play a fundamental role in vaccine development, gene therapy, and therapeutic production. Their biological properties are harnessed to advance medicine and public health. Beyond immunization, microorganisms contribute to gut health, antibiotic synthesis, and genetic disease treatment.Live Attenuated and Inactivated VaccinesLive attenuated vaccines, such as the measles, mumps, and rubella (MMR) vaccine, utilize weakened forms of pathogens to closely resemble natural infections.
